EAE KNX Room Control Unit
Product Manual RCXXYY
Note:
RC2018
RC2000
RC1616
RC1600
RC1212
RC1200
RC0808
RC0800
RCXXYY where XX denotes the number of outputs and YY number of inputs.
Input and Output numbers are as in the table.
20 Output, 18 Input
20 Output, No Input
16 Output, 16 Input
16 Output, No Input
12 Output, 12 Input
12 Output, No Input
8 Output, 8 Input
8 Output, No Input

    Product Manual RCXXYY EAE KNX Room Control Unit RCXXYY PM R3.0 Monitoring period for wind alarm in s *0…1000 [0…1000] The telegram of the active weather station is monitored cyclically. The actuator waits for a telegram from the weather station within the cycle time. If the telegram is not received within this monitoring period time, actuator assumes that the weather station is broken or bus line is damaged and the blind moves into the parameterized position.

    Product Manual RCXXYY EAE KNX Room Control Unit RCXXYY PM R3.0 4.2.1 a - Switch Sensor This function is used, for binary inputs to which a switch or a push button is attached, to send a switching telegram (ON, OFF or TOGGLE) as a reaction to a rising and / or falling signal edge at this input.
  • Page 23 Product Manual RCXXYY EAE KNX Room Control Unit RCXXYY PM R3.0 Short/Long Press: Distinguishing short from long presses is about measuring the pulse length. The event is no longer emitted upon pressing the button, but upon releasing it. This can affect the feeling of responsiveness.

    Product Manual RCXXYY EAE KNX Room Control Unit RCXXYY PM R3.0 4.5.2 A/B – Drive Blind The blind actuator calculates the current position of a blind from the running time. This calculation has to be performed because the drive cannot provide any feedback on its position.

    Product Manual RCXXYY EAE KNX Room Control Unit RCXXYY PM R3.0 Rain alarm Frost alarm Active weather sensors can be monitored cyclically. The device expects a telegram from sensor within the cycle time. If the telegram doesn’t receive within the cycle time or the value 1 is received, the blinds are moved to parameterized position.
